FTC Concerns Regarding Data Privacy and ChatGPT
The FTC's investigation into OpenAI centers heavily on concerns regarding data privacy and ChatGPT's handling of user information. The commission is scrutinizing OpenAI's practices to determine if they comply with existing data privacy regulations and protect user data effectively. The focus is on whether OpenAI is adequately safeguarding sensitive information and acting transparently with users about data collection and usage.
Potential violations being investigated include:
- Unauthorized collection of personal data: Concerns exist about whether OpenAI is collecting more data than necessary or collecting data without explicit user consent. This is especially pertinent given the vast amounts of text data ChatGPT processes.
- Insufficient transparency regarding data usage: The FTC is likely examining the clarity and comprehensiveness of OpenAI's privacy policies. Are users fully informed about how their data is used, shared, and protected?
- Lack of robust data security measures: The FTC will assess the security measures implemented by OpenAI to protect user data from breaches and unauthorized access. Given the sensitive nature of the data, robust security protocols are paramount.
- Potential for biases in data leading to unfair or discriminatory outcomes: The data used to train ChatGPT could contain inherent biases, potentially leading to unfair or discriminatory outputs. The FTC is investigating whether OpenAI has taken adequate steps to mitigate these risks.
These concerns have significant implications for ChatGPT users. If the FTC finds violations, it could lead to substantial fines, legal action, and a loss of user trust, potentially impacting ChatGPT's future adoption and development. The Impact of Algorithmic Bias in ChatGPT
Algorithmic bias in AI models like ChatGPT is a significant ethical and legal concern. These models learn from vast datasets, and if these datasets reflect societal biases (e.g., gender, race, socioeconomic status), the AI system will perpetuate and potentially amplify those biases. This can lead to unfair or discriminatory outcomes, impacting individuals and communities disproportionately.
Examples of potential biases in ChatGPT include:
- Generating stereotypical responses related to gender, race, or profession.
- Exhibiting bias in factual information retrieval, reflecting pre-existing prejudices in the training data.
- Showing preference towards certain viewpoints or perspectives over others.
The challenges of identifying and mitigating bias in large language models are substantial. However, the FTC is keenly interested in ensuring fairness in AI and non-discrimination. The investigation underscores the need for AI accountability and mechanisms to ensure ethical AI development and deployment. Failure to address these issues could result in significant legal ramifications for OpenAI, including fines and reputational damage. OpenAI's Response to the FTC Investigation
OpenAI has publicly acknowledged the FTC's investigation and issued statements expressing its commitment to data privacy and user safety. The company has also outlined steps taken to address algorithmic bias and improve its data handling practices. However, the effectiveness of OpenAI's response remains to be seen.
OpenAI's actions include:
- OpenAI's commitment to data privacy and user safety: Public statements reiterate a dedication to responsible data handling and user protection.
- Steps taken to address algorithmic bias: The company has announced efforts to improve data curation and model training to reduce bias.
- Changes in data collection and usage policies: Modifications to privacy policies aim for greater transparency and user control.
However, the long-term impact of these actions requires further monitoring. The FTC's investigation will likely determine the sufficiency of OpenAI's response. Future actions by OpenAI could include increased investment in bias detection and mitigation technologies, further refinement of data privacy policies, and enhanced transparency mechanisms.
